PROCESS FOR THE PREPARATION OF A BIMETALLIC CATALYST BASED ON NICKEL AND COPPER FOR THE HYDROGENATION OF AROMATIC COMPOUNDS

A process for the preparation of a catalyst comprising a bimetallic active phase based on nickel and copper, and a support comprising a refractory oxide comprising the following steps: a step is taken to bring the support into contact with a solution containing a precursor of nickel; a step is taken to bring the support into contact with a solution containing a copper precursor; a step is taken to dry the catalyst precursor at a temperature below 250 ° C .; the catalyst precursor obtained is supplied in a hydrogenation reactor and a reduction step is carried out by contacting said precursor with a reducing gas at a temperature of less than 200 ° C. for a period greater than or equal to 5 minutes and less 2 hours.
